Choosing the Right Amp for Beginners: Fender Mustang 1 v2 vs. Line 6 Pod HD50
Choosing the Right Amp for Beginners: Fender Mustang 1 v2 vs. Line 6 Pod HD50
For beginners embarking on their musical journey, choosing an amplifier can be a daunting task. Two popular options that often come up are the Fender Mustang 1 v2 and the Line 6 Pod HD50. Both amps offer unique features and cater to different needs. Let’s break down each amp and help you decide which might be the best fit for your playing style.
Fender Mustang 1 v2
The Fender Mustang 1 v2 is a versatile small combo amp designed for home practice and small gigs. This powerful little amp is part of the Mustang series and is known for its clean and synergistic tone. However, strictly speaking, the Mustang 1 v2 IS NOT intended for regular, large gigs; it is more suited for small rehearsals or home use. That being said, playing with headphones is doable, but it’s not the primary purpose of this gear. It comes with a variety of preset sounds, but the real fun lies in customizing your own tones. The amp’s display screen is quite small, so having a companion editing program is highly recommended for a better user experience.
Line 6 Pod HD50
The Line 6 Pod HD50, on the other hand, is a pedalboard-style effects simulator that excels in versatility and sound quality. While it is slightly smaller than a full-sized amplifier, this compact powerhouse is perfect for playing with headphones, which is ideal for beginners who want to train without disturbing others. It comes with a vast selection of tone settings and effects. Additionally, you can download presets from other users, allowing you to access a wide range of professional sounds. The Pod HD50 also excels in live performances, as it can be used with a sound system to amplify your sound during gigs. The main benefit of using the Pod HD50 is its ability to simulate a wide range of guitar tones through your headphones, enabling you to practice and record without dealing with messy cables or noisy environments.

Additional Considerations
If you are looking for a similar experience to the Line 6 Pod HD50 but with better sound quality and more versatility, consider brands like Blackstar. Blackstar offers the ID-15 TVP and the ID:BEAM, both of which provide excellent sound and are designed with both beginners and professional musicians in mind. The ID-15 TVP is great for band settings and delivers powerful sound, whereas the ID:BEAM is more suited for individual use or small rehearsals. The ID:BEAM even has a Bluetooth feature, making it convenient for modern music production.
